Transaction 647435795704ba2dc38e24cc908579ef602cdc7e7c0dcbd221c5a51c882b3f66
1 Input
1 Output
-
647435795704ba2dc38e24cc908579ef602cdc7e7c0dcbd221c5a51c882b3f66:0
- value
- 134987
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f7466a60635ba41d4421e0fb8a1ca891d2dede8 OP_EQUAL
- address
- 336jW6ttrqdEdwcpn6jJaEvMRy1c7fFdTf